Sony Security Cameras Installed At Two Honduras Cities To Combat High Crime Levels

Over 3,800 Sony network security cameras contribute to a greater sense of public safety – and lower crime rates – in the Republic of Honduras’ two biggest cities of San Pedro Sula and Tegucigalpa. In order to combat high crime levels, the Honduran government Ministry of Security established the country’s 911 National Emergency System in 2015. ShotSpotter Detected Over 86,000 Gunfire Incidents Across The United States In 2017

ShotSpotter, the provider of gunshot detection solutions that help law enforcement officers and security personnel identify, locate and deter gun violence, announced results of their annual ShotSpotter National Gunfire Index (NGI) report, a gunfire incident report based on 87 U.S. cities using ShotSpotter technology during 2017.
